We are seeking an Occupational Therapist with proven leadership experience to join our #AAA Port Macquarie team. 

In this role you will:

  • Build a collaborative, supportive team environment that drives high-quality clinical outcomes
  • Provide 1:1 clinical supervision, mentoring, and professional development to graduate and early career OTs, alongside operational support.
  • Manage your own caseload while delivering timely, high-quality therapy services to NDIS participants across home, school, and community settings.
  • Assessing participants with complex emotional, cognitive, developmental, and physical needs
  • Using clinical observation and standardised assessments to develop evidence-based therapy goals
  • Supporting team operations, referral allocation, and NDIS compliance
